What are the windmills called that generate electricity?

What is a Wind Turbine? Huge windmills, also called wind turbines, typically have two or three blades that turn when the wind blows fast enough. These turbines are strategically installed in windy places and are often grouped together in “farms” for the greatest efficiency.

How long can windmills generate electricity?

At a 33% capacity factor, that average turbine would generate over 402,000 kWh per month – enough for over 460 average U.S. homes. To put it another way, the average wind turbine generates enough energy in 94 minutes to power an average U.S. home for one month.

Do wind turbines have motors to start them?

Large-scale wind turbines normally have a braking system that kicks in around 55 mph to prevent damage to the blades. Ironically, many industrial-scale wind turbines require an electric ‘kick-start’ to begin turning.

How do windmills conduct electricity?

An electric windmill works by using the energy available in wind. The wind runs over the blades, which forces them to rotate. A shaft connected to the blades turns gears inside the windmill, which in turn spins a magnetic rotor. This causes electromagnetic induction to take place, which produces an electrical current…

How does a windmill produce electricity?

As its name states, the windmill’s only source of energy is derived from the wind. The wind turns the blades which spins a shaft , in turn, prompt a generator to produce electricity. These blades are connected to a generator, sometimes through a gearbox and sometimes directly.
